Deepika Padukone retorts to the stories of starring in Iranian filmmaker Majid Majidi's next!




Deepika Padukone's pictures in a de-glam look with much-admired Iranian filmmaker Majid Majidi created a huge stir on the Internet last week. Rumours have been widespread that Deepika is collaborating with the Majidi for his next directorial endeavor, who has made classics like Children of Heaven (1997), The Color of Paradise (1999) and Baran (2001).

Seemingly, Deepika's day long shoot at Dhobi Ghat in Mumbai was held only for Majidi to gauge if the actress' look suited a prime character in his movie. 

At an event lately, Deepika was asked about her alleged international project. To this, she answered to a media agency, "You will know soon." 

Presently, Deepika is gearing up for the release of her maiden Hollywood debut, xXx: Return of Xander Cage. If the Majidi-Deepika's alliance happens, this won't be the filmmaker's first tryst with Indian artists. Majid's 2015 film Muhammad: The Messenger of God music was scored by AR Rahman.
